Skip to content

Commit e81e7fd

Browse files
Hristo Ilievhsiliev
Hristo Iliev
authored andcommitted
feat: disable OPA plugin on Windows
OPA does not recognize Windows 10 and 11: Bisnode/opa-gradle-plugin#120
1 parent 987c71f commit e81e7fd

File tree

1 file changed

+4
-1
lines changed

1 file changed

+4
-1
lines changed

build.gradle.kts

+4-1
Original file line numberDiff line numberDiff line change
@@ -2,6 +2,7 @@ import com.bisnode.opa.configuration.ExecutableMode
22
import com.bmuschko.gradle.docker.tasks.image.DockerBuildImage
33
import com.github.gradle.node.npm.task.NpmTask
44
import io.smallrye.openapi.api.OpenApiConfig
5+
import org.apache.tools.ant.taskdefs.condition.Os
56
import java.util.Locale
67
import org.openapitools.generator.gradle.plugin.tasks.GenerateTask
78

@@ -379,7 +380,9 @@ tasks {
379380

380381
test {
381382
dependsOn("npmRunTest")
382-
dependsOn("testRegoCoverage")
383+
if(!Os.isFamily(Os.FAMILY_WINDOWS)) {
384+
dependsOn("testRegoCoverage")
385+
}
383386
}
384387

385388
compileJava {

0 commit comments

Comments
 (0)